2. ElevenLabs
ElevenLabs delivers high-quality, expressive voices that make it a top-tier cartoon voice generator. You get control over pitch, pacing, and emotion, which is ideal for creating character-driven video projects.

Key Features
- The voices flow naturally, which helps cartoon characters sound more believable during conversations.
- Generates lifelike cartoon voices that capture emotion and nuance.
- Simple UI with adjustable stability and clarity settings.
- Supports voice cloning for consistent character portrayal.
- It's a web-based tool, you don't need to worry about device compatibility.
- It needs a steady internet connection.
- Strong features come with a higher cost at scale.
- Voice cloning and advanced controls may have a slight learning curve for beginners.
- ElevenLabs holds a 4.6 out of 5 star rating on G2.
- It is earning praise for its natural-sounding voices and cloning performance. Users note it "feels like working with real voice actors," and they praise the UI's ease of use.

What's the difference between a cartoon voice generator and a real-time voice changer?
A cartoon voice generator usually converts text into cartoon-style voices using AI. A real-time voice changer, on the other hand, modifies your live voice as you speak. It's suitable for gaming, streaming, or live content. -
